To set the recording mode on the Canon VIXIA HF G21, turn the camera on, press the 'FUNC' button, and select the desired recording mode from the menu options such as AVCHD or MP4.
Use the supplied USB cable to connect the camera to your computer. Ensure the camera is powered on and set to playback mode, then follow the prompts on your computer to transfer the files.
Check if the battery is charged and properly inserted. If the battery is charged and the camera still does not turn on, try using the AC adapter to power it. If the problem persists, the camera may require servicing.
To perform a factory reset, go to the 'Menu', select 'System Setup', and choose 'Reset All'. Confirm the action and the camera will return to its default settings.
Ensure the lens is clean and the focus mode is set appropriately for your subject. You can switch between manual and auto-focus using the focus ring or the camera menu.
To extend battery life, reduce the LCD screen brightness, turn on the power-saving mode, and avoid unnecessary zooming and playback. Carry a spare battery for longer sessions.
The Canon VIXIA HF G21 is compatible with SD, SDHC, and SDXC memory cards. For best performance, use Class 10 or UHS-I rated cards.
Use a soft, lint-free cloth or a lens cleaning brush to gently remove dust and smudges. Avoid using any harsh chemicals or rough materials that could damage the lens.
Increase the ISO setting, open the aperture, or use the 'Low Light' mode available in the camera's scene modes to enhance performance in dim conditions.
First, try turning the camera off and back on. If the issue continues, remove the battery and reinsert it. If the problem persists, consider contacting Canon support for further assistance.
